Transaction e0590e184c64cd3e921fb9172ee1d907a9c0629525a9eae8054e5631342759cf

2 Input
2 Outputs
  • e0590e184c64cd3e921fb9172ee1d907a9c0629525a9eae8054e5631342759cf:0
  • value  268084922
    address  12cf6Vh9ywWujVfHXcLqAPWPV8H3e9Y12S
  • e0590e184c64cd3e921fb9172ee1d907a9c0629525a9eae8054e5631342759cf:1
  • value  1944321060
    address  1E9GzMWMe74uMGrKv4iNrxi7fn3XwoQJk9